I take it from the following message that var/spool/mqueue is low on disk space but when I look at the available disk space with bdf and I get 43350 kbytes free on /var. The message is not coming from another machine on the network so it must be from a local process on my machine. I presume that the process is attempting to send a file to me which has been refused by the mail server. Has anyone seent his before and is there a solution that I might use.

Re: sendmail[816]: NOQUEUE: low on space (have 0, SMTP-DAEMON needs 101 in /var/spool/mqueue)
The sendmail.cf option MinFreeBlocks is normally set to 100 - this is what you're hitting. I would probably leave it as is, and try and clear space from this filesystem.
